A successful DeltaV I/O migration rarely involves a single card swap. In most plant environments, the DC-PDIL51 or DC-TDIL51 operates alongside a broader ecosystem of DeltaV hardware that must be evaluated as part of any upgrade or replacement project.
On the output side, the DC-PDOB51 digital output module is the natural companion to the DC-PDIL51, sharing the same carrier and backplane architecture. When replacing a failed input module, engineers frequently audit adjacent output cards at the same time to avoid repeat maintenance visits. Similarly, the DC-PAOX11 analog output module and DC-PAIX11 analog input module are commonly found in the same I/O cabinet, and their condition should be assessed during any planned outage.
The DeltaV M-series controller — including variants such as the MD Plus and MD Controller — governs the I/O subsystem and must be confirmed compatible with the firmware revision of any replacement digital input module. In older installations, the DeltaV I/O carrier DC-CARD2 or DC-CARD8 may require inspection to ensure the card slot contacts are clean and undamaged before inserting a new DC-PDIL51.
For sites migrating from Honeywell’s legacy TDC 3000 or HPM (High-Performance Process Manager) platform, the transition to DeltaV I/O typically involves remapping field wiring through new marshalling terminal blocks. The DeltaV CHARM I/O architecture is an alternative path for greenfield expansions, but for brownfield replacements where existing wiring must be preserved, the DC-PDIL51 remains the most cost-effective and lowest-risk solution.
Power integrity is critical in any DCS cabinet. The PS6 DeltaV power supply and associated redundant power modules should be verified for adequate capacity when adding or replacing I/O cards. Communication continuity between the controller and I/O subsystem depends on the DeltaV I/O bus terminator being correctly installed at the end of each carrier chain — a detail that is often overlooked during emergency replacements.

Q1: Can the DC-PDIL51 be installed without re-wiring existing field cables?
Yes. The DC-PDIL51 and DC-TDIL51 use the same marshalling terminal block interface as the original DeltaV digital input cards. Field wiring connects to the terminal block, not directly to the module, so a card swap does not require any re-termination of field cables. Verify that the terminal block model matches the carrier slot before insertion.
Q2: Is the DC-TDIL51 a direct replacement for the DC-PDIL51?
The DC-TDIL51 is functionally equivalent to the DC-PDIL51 and is accepted as a direct replacement in most DeltaV configurations. Both modules share the same 32-channel digital input architecture, DeltaV I/O bus protocol, and physical form factor. Confirm the firmware compatibility with your DeltaV controller version before commissioning.
Q3: Will replacing this module require changes to the DeltaV control strategy or programming?
In standard replacement scenarios, no programming changes are required. The DeltaV system recognizes the module by its hardware type and slot address. If the replacement module is the same model or a confirmed equivalent, the existing I/O assignments, alarm limits, and control logic remain intact. A controller download may be required if the module was previously unregistered.
Q4: What physical space and power requirements should be verified before installation?
The DC-PDIL51 occupies one slot in a standard DeltaV 2, 4, or 8-slot I/O carrier. Confirm that the target slot is unoccupied or that the failed card has been removed. The module draws power from the carrier backplane; no separate power connection is required. Ensure the cabinet power supply (typically the PS6 or equivalent) has sufficient headroom for the additional I/O load.
